| ## π Quick Start | |
| ### Installation | |
| 1. **Install Ollama** (if not already installed): | |
| ```bash | |
| curl -fsSL https://ollama.com/install.sh | sh | |
| ``` | |
| 2. **Pull the NeuralQuantum model**: | |
| ```bash | |
| ollama pull neuralquantum/ollama | |
| ``` | |
| 3. **Run the model**: | |
| ```bash | |
| ollama run neuralquantum/ollama | |
| ``` | |
| ### Basic Usage | |
| ```bash | |
| # Start a conversation | |
| ollama run neuralquantum/ollama | |
| # Ask a question | |
| >>> What is quantum computing and how does it enhance AI? | |
| # The model will provide a quantum-enhanced response | |
| ``` | |
| ### API Usage | |
| ```bash | |
| # Generate text via API | |
| curl http://localhost:11434/api/generate -d '{ | |
| "model": "neuralquantum/ollama", | |
| "prompt": "Explain quantum machine learning", | |
| "stream": false | |
| }' | |
| ``` | |

| ### Custom Modelfile | |
| You can create custom configurations by modifying the Modelfile: | |
| ```dockerfile | |
| FROM neuralquantum/nqlm | |
| # Custom parameters | |
| PARAMETER temperature 0.8 | |
| PARAMETER top_p 0.95 | |
| PARAMETER num_ctx 4096 | |
| # Custom system prompt | |
| SYSTEM "Your custom system prompt here..." | |
| ``` | |
